The second-hand books market has seen considerable growth, advancing from $23.7 billion in 2023 to $25.32 billion in 2024,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.8%. Key drivers include increased consumer interest in affordable reading materials, rising environmental awareness promoting reuse, expansion of literacy programs, and economic factors influencing book purchases. The market is projected to reach $33.15 billion by 2028, with a CAGR of 7%. This growth is driven by the growing value placed on unique and vintage books, changing consumer preferences, and the expansion of global markets. Notable trends include advancements in digital learning materials, increased use of digital libraries, and innovations in logistics and shipping solutions.

The second-hand book market is projected to grow due to an increasing number of readers and heightened interest in affordable, sustainable literature. Advances in digital book access and ongoing literacy efforts contribute to this trend. According to THGM Writing Services, a January 2023 survey of 945 book readers revealed that 27% read more than 20 books in 2022, and 64% plan to increase their book consumption in 2023. This expanding reader base is expected to drive the second-hand book market from $0.78 billion in 2023 to $0.85 billion in 2024, with projections reaching $1.21 billion by 2028.

Key Second Hand Books Market Trend

Major companies in the second-hand book market are leveraging strategic partnerships to expand their reach and enhance service offerings. In June 2021, Bookbarn International partnered with World of Books Group to launch the AuthorSHARE Royalty Scheme, optimizing the availability of second-hand books. This collaboration strengthens their market position and ensures a sustainable distribution model for used books.
